HS6207 is a micro-power, high-sensitivity, omnipolar Hall switch sensor with latch output, which can directly replace the traditional reed switch. It is particularly suitable for portable electronic products using battery power, such as mobile phones, cordless phones, notebook computers, PDAs, etc.
HS6207 has magnetic field identification omnipolarity, that is, it can be activated as long as the north pole or south pole of the magnetic field is close, and the output will be turned off after the magnetic field is removed. Unlike other general Hall sensor devices, it does not require a specific south pole or north pole to operate, which reduces the trouble of identifying the magnetic pole during assembly. The product uses dynamic offset elimination technology, which can eliminate the offset voltage caused by package stress, thermal stress, and temperature gradient, and improve the consistency of the device.
The internal circuit of HS6207 includes Hall film, voltage regulator module, signal amplification processing module, dynamic offset elimination module, latch module and CMOS output stage. Due to the use of advanced Bi-CMOS technology, the overall optimized circuit structure enables the product to obtain extremely low input error feedback. At the same time, the product adopts a very miniaturized packaging process, which makes the product have extremely high performance and market advantages.
HS6207 provides two packages, TSOT23-3 and TO-92S, with an operating temperature range of -40~150℃.
